Former Kasese Woman MP Joins LC V Race

Politics
Loyce Biira Bwambale, the former Kasese Woman Member of parliament has joined the race for the district LC V seat.

This brings to four the number of aspirants eyeing Kasese District LC V seat.

Other candidates are Rev. Canon Julius Kithaghenda the incumbent, Joshua Masereka the his vice and Rt. Lt. Col. Dole Mawa

Bwambale has already commissioned a huge team of campaign agents to solicit support for her bid to be elected as the official NRM candidate.

She says that despite the fact that she has joined the race several months behind her rivals she is confident to defeat them in the polls.

Bwambale says that she is going to use her experience and record as a former legislator to defeat her opponents.

She is also currently the deputy premier in Rwenzurur Kingdom.

It is not yet clear, whether Bwambale has already resigned her seat in the Kingdom because traditional leaders are barred from joining active politics.
